Salman Khan‘s Maatrubhumi remains one of the most anticipated movies of 2026. Directed by Apoorva Lakhia, the film was initially slated to release in April 2026, but was postponed indefinitely due to reshoots and revisions to the script. While previous reports pointed to the film being released in the second half of 2026, a new report now suggests that the film could be delayed until 2027. This will leave Salman without a single film to release in 2026. However, fans can be compensated in 2027 with the potential release of two films: Maatrubhumi: Rest in Peace and SVC 63.
Salman Khan’s film faces defense ministry concern
According to Bollywood Hungama, Maatrubhumi’s release was delayed because the Ministry of Defense raised concerns over certain content in the film, including references to China. These issues remain unresolved to this day.

Salman Khan plays Colonel B Santosh Babu in Maatrubhumi
“Maatrubhumi – RIP” stars Chitrangada Singh and Salman Khan as Colonel B Santosh Babu. The story is rooted in the 2020 Galwan Valley conflict between Indian and Chinese armies. The makers have released a trailer and some video songs to build excitement ahead of the release.
